Shujinko ³Ô¹ÏÍø Central

  • Restaurant
  • Takeaway

Craving a taste of Tokyo in the heart of ³Ô¹ÏÍø? Tucked away in ³Ô¹ÏÍø Central, Shujinko Ramen is a cosy favourite serving up some of the city's most comforting bowls of ramen, alongside other Japanese classics that hit just as hard.

The signature tonkotsu ramen is a must-try: rich, creamy pork broth, perfectly cooked noodles, tender chashu, and a jammy soy egg. Feeling bold? Opt for the karakuchi ramen, which brings the heat without overpowering the dish’s deep umami.

But ramen isn’t the only hero here. Locals love the karaage rice bowl, topped with golden, crispy fried chicken, and the katsu curry, served just the way it should be – crispy cutlet, rich curry and fluffy rice.
